Synopsis
The global market for Rod Mill was estimated to be worth US$ 164 million in 2024 and is forecast to a readjusted size of US$ 235 million by 2031 with a CAGR of 5.1% during the forecast period 2025-2031.
A rod mill is a crucial piece of equipment used in the mining, construction, iron manufacturing, and chemical industries for grinding and pulverizing materials. It works similarly to a ball mill, using rods or balls to crush and grind materials through friction. Compared to other types of mills, rod mills are particularly suitable for both wet and dry grinding processes, offering efficient and uniform grinding results. They are widely used for crushing and processing a variety of materials.
Rod mills are categorized into two main types: wet grinding and dry grinding. Among these, wet grinding rod mills dominate the global market, accounting for approximately 69.7% of the market share. Wet grinding rod mills are particularly well-suited for the mining industry, where they process different mineral ores, providing efficient and consistent grinding performance.
Dry grinding rod mills, on the other hand, are used for materials that are sensitive to moisture, such as those in iron manufacturing. While their market share is smaller compared to wet grinding rod mills, dry grinding mills are still in demand for specific industrial applications.
The growth of the rod mill market is closely tied to the demands from the mining, construction, iron manufacturing, and chemical industries. Particularly in the mining sector, where they account for approximately 47.5% of the market share.
The Asia-Pacific region is the largest consumer market for rod mills, accounting for 37% of global revenue. This region is not only a key player in global mineral resource extraction but also an important market for iron manufacturing and construction industries. Therefore, the demand for rod mills in the Asia-Pacific region is expected to continue growing in the coming years.
Market Drivers
Several factors are driving the growth of the rod mill market. One of the key drivers is the accelerated development of global mineral resources, particularly in the Asia-Pacific region. As mining activities increase, there is a growing demand for high-efficiency grinding equipment, particularly in mineral ore processing. Wet grinding rod mills are ideal for processing fine-grained ores, offering uniform grinding results and driving their widespread use in the mining industry.
Another driver is the growth of the construction industry. With urbanization progressing rapidly, the construction sector requires more processed raw materials, and rod mills are used extensively in cement production and sand aggregate processing. In cement production, rod mills not only improve grinding efficiency but also reduce environmental impact during production.
In the iron manufacturing industry, rod mills are used for coarse grinding of ores and efficient processing of raw materials in steel production. As the global steel industry continues to expand, the demand for rod mills to enhance production efficiency and reduce operational costs is increasing.
Additionally, the chemical industry is seeing growing demand for rod mills. The chemical production process requires fine-grained materials and efficient production processes, and rod mills provide the necessary grinding precision. This trend is especially prevalent in the production of fine chemicals and materials.
Market Challenges
Despite the strong growth prospects, the rod mill market faces several challenges. One of the main challenges is the high initial investment cost of the equipment. While rod mills offer long-term efficiency benefits, the upfront cost for purchasing and installing the equipment can be significant, especially for small to medium-sized enterprises. This initial financial burden may deter potential customers from adopting rod mills.
Another challenge is the environmental concerns related to water usage in wet grinding rod mills. In regions where water resources are scarce, the water requirement for wet grinding may become a limitation, thus making dry grinding rod mills a more attractive option in certain areas.
Furthermore, competition in the global rod mill market is intensifying, with more companies entering the field and offering various types of mills with different capabilities. This increased competition pushes companies to innovate continually and improve the efficiency and environmental sustainability of their products.
Lastly, global economic fluctuations may impact the rod mill market. The performance of industries such as mining, construction, and chemical manufacturing directly affects the demand for rod mills. During periods of economic uncertainty, companies may delay investments in new equipment, affecting the market growth.
